The student is wrong because geographic separation (allopatric speciation) is only one route to forming new species. Speciation can also occur without a physical barrier and can be driven by biological interactions, genetic changes, or ecological opportunity. Briefly:

1. Modes of speciation other than allopatry
- Sympatric speciation: reproductive isolation evolves within a single, overlapping population (e.g., polyploidy in plants, or host‑shift in insects such as Rhagoletis).
- Parapatric/peripatric speciation: neighboring populations diverge along environmental gradients or by founder effects without complete long‑term geographic isolation.
- Hybrid speciation: hybrids of two species can become reproductively isolated and form a new species.

2. Mechanisms that cause reproductive isolation
- Biological forces: sexual selection, mate choice, host preference, behavioral changes, and ecological selection can produce reproductive isolation even with no geographic barrier.
- Genetic changes: mutations (including polyploidy), chromosomal rearrangements, and accumulation of incompatible alleles (Dobzhansky–Muller incompatibilities) drive divergence.
- Variation: standing genetic variation and new mutations provide the raw material for divergent selection and drift.

3. Adaptive radiation
- Adaptive radiation does produce speciation — it’s a pattern in which a single lineage rapidly diversifies into many species adapted to different niches (e.g., Darwin’s finches, cichlids). So the statement “Speciation does not result from adaptive radiation” is false.

In short: geographic separation is a frequent pathway but not the only one — biological, genetic, and ecological processes can create reproductive isolation and produce new species without physical barriers.
